We are looking for a qualified Commercial HVAC Foreman with 8+ years of experience, also leads the field execution of HVAC and mechanical construction projects, ensuring work is completed safely, on schedule, and to quality standards. This role oversees crews and subcontractors, coordinates daily jobsite activities, and serves as the primary field leader supporting project profitability, productivity, and safety outcomes.

Your Duties and Responsibilities Field Leadership & Execution
Lead HVAC field crews on large or complex commercial/industrial projects
Plan and execute daily and weekly work activities in alignment with project schedules
Coordinate manpower, tools, equipment, and materials
Read and interpret drawings, specs, and project documents
Resolve field issues and coordinate with Project Managers and Superintendents
Productivity & Cost Control
Drive labor productivity and efficient work practices
Track time, material usage, and production quantities
Support job cost management by minimizing rework and downtime
Identify potential scope gaps or change order opportunities
Safety & Compliance
Enforce company safety policies and OSHA requirements
Lead daily safety huddles and toolbox talks
Conduct jobsite safety walks and correct unsafe behaviors immediately
Promote a safety-first culture on every jobsite
Quality Control
Ensure installations meet drawings, specs, and code requirements
Perform quality checks and inspections prior to turnover
Support commissioning and punch list completion
Reduce rework through proactive quality management
Team Leadership & Development
Lead, train, and mentor HVAC technicians and apprentices
Promote accountability, teamwork, and strong work ethic
Assist in onboarding new field employees
Provide feedback on crew performance and development needs
Coordination & Communication
Act as the primary field liaison with Project Managers and Superintendents
Coordinate with other trades and site leadership
Participate in coordination meetings and schedule planning
Communicate material needs and field constraints early
